Waka Flocka
Juaquin James Malphurs (born May 31, 1986), known professionally as Waka Flocka Flame, is an American rapper. He first became known for his 2009 single "O Let's Do It", which entered the ''Billboard'' Hot 100 and led him to sign with Gucci Mane's 1017 Records, an imprint of Warner Records that same year. His 2010 follow-up single, "No Hands" (featuring Roscoe Dash and Wale) reached number 13 on the chart and received diamond certification by the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A). Both songs, along with "Hard in da Paint" and " Grove St. Party" (featuring Kebo Gotti), preceded the release of his debut studio album ''Flockaveli'' (2010), which peaked at number six on the ''Billboard'' 200. His second studio album, '' Triple F Life: Friends, Fans & Family'' (2012) peaked at number ten on the chart and was supported by the singles " Round of Applause" (featuring Drake), " I Don't Really Care" (featuring Trey Songz) and " Get Low" (featuring Tyga, Nicki Minaj and Fl ...

New York City
New York, often called New York City (NYC), is the most populous city in the United States, located at the southern tip of New York State on one of the world's largest natural harbors. The city comprises five boroughs, each coextensive with a respective county. The city is the geographical and demographic center of both the Northeast megalopolis and the New York metropolitan area, the largest metropolitan area in the United States by both population and urban area. New York is a global center of finance and commerce, culture, technology, entertainment and media, academics, and scientific output, the arts and fashion, and, as home to the headquarters of the United Nations, international diplomacy. With an estimated population in 2024 of 8,478,072 distributed over , the city is the most densely populated major city in the United States. New York City has more than double the population of Los Angeles, the nation's second-most populous city.

Zaytoven
Xavier Lamar Dotson (born January 12, 1980), known professionally as Zaytoven, is an American record producer from Atlanta, Georgia. He has released collaborative projects with artists including Gucci Mane, Usher, Future, Young Dolph, Migos, Lecrae, Lil Yachty, Chief Keef, Young Scooter, B.o.B, Boosie Badazz, Waka Flocka Flame, 21 Savage, Deitrick Haddon and La Fève. Zaytoven signed with Gucci Mane's 1017 Records as an in-house producer after producing the latter's 2005 single " Icy". He was credited on Usher's 2009 single " Papers", which peaked within the ''Billboard'' Hot 100's top 40. Early life Dotson spent a lot of time at church growing up, as his father was a preacher when not working for the army. He learned to play instruments through the church bands along with his three younger siblings. He gravitated toward playing the piano and organ. Billboard 200
The ''Billboard'' 200 is a record chart ranking the 200 most popular music albums and EPs in the United States. It is published weekly by '' Billboard'' magazine to convey the popularity of an artist or groups of artists. Sometimes, a recording act is remembered for its " number ones" that outperformed all other albums during at least one week. The chart grew from a weekly top 10 list in 1956 to become a top 200 list in May 1967, acquiring its existing name in March 1992. Its previous names include the ''Billboard'' Top LPs (1961–1972), ''Billboard'' Top LPs & Tape (1972–1984), ''Billboard'' Top 200 Albums (1984–1985), ''Billboard'' Top Pop Albums (1985–1991), and ''Billboard'' 200 Top Albums (1991–1992). The chart is based mostly on sales—both at retail and digital – of albums in the United States. Flockaveli
''Flockaveli'' is the debut studio album by American rapper Waka Flocka Flame. It was released through 1017 Brick Squad, Asylum, and Warner Bros. Records on October 5, 2010. The title of the album is a portmanteau of Waka Flocka Flame's name and that of the Italian political theorist Machiavelli, and was inspired by fellow American rapper Tupac Shakur, whose final stage name and pseudonym before his death was Makaveli. The album was recorded at Next Level Studios in Houston, NightBird Recording Studios in West Hollywood, and S-Line Ent. in Atlanta. Upon its release, ''Flockaveli'' received generally positive reviews from critics, who complimented its musical intensity, brazen lyrics, and gangsta rap ethos. The album debuted at number 6 on the ''Billboard'' 200, with first-week sales of 37,000 copies in the United States. As of August 15, 2011, the album sold 400,000 copies in the United States. Kebo Gotti
Kebo Gotti is an American rapper. Career Gotti appeared on the Waka Flocka Flame single, " Grove St. Party", the fourth and final single from Flame's debut album, ''Flockaveli'' (2010). The music video for "Grove St. Party" includes Kebo, Gucci Mane and YC. On February 27, 2011, "Grove St. Party" entered at #38 on the U.S. ''Billboard'' R&B/Hip-Hop Tracks chart, peaking at #12. It also climbed the ''Billboard'' Rap Songs charts, reaching #10, and on the U.S. ''Billboard'' Hot 100 at #74. Hard In Da Paint
"Hard in da Paint" is the second single from American rapper Waka Flocka Flame's debut studio album ''Flockaveli''. Background Waka Flocka's "Hard in da Paint", like his previous hit " O Let's Do It", was originally a mixtape track. It first appeared as 'Go Hard' on his third mixtape titled ''Salute Me Or Shoot Me 2'', released on August 24, 2009. An early remix featuring French Montana was released on April 19, 2010, and appeared in the latter's ninth mixtape titled ''Mac & Cheese 2'', released on May 6. The track was produced by up-and-coming producer Lex Luger, and went on to become an underground hit before being released as a commercial single on May 13. Music video The music video was released on July 19, 2010. During the music video the production was shut down by gang activity and police presence due to the Black P. Stones Bloods gang injunction. Recording Industry Association Of America
The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A) is a trade organization that represents the music recording industry in the United States. Its members consist of record labels and distributors that the RIAA says "create, manufacture, and/or distribute approximately 85% of all legally sold recorded music in the United States". RIAA is headquartered in Washington, D.C. RIAA was formed in 1952. Its original mission was to administer recording copyright fees and problems, work with trade unions, and do research relating to the record industry and government regulations. Early RIAA standards included the RIAA equalization curve, the format of the stereophonic record groove and the dimensions of 33 1/3, 45, and 78 rpm records. Wale (rapper)
Olubowale Victor Akintimehin (born September 21, 1984), known professionally as Wale ( ), is an American rapper. He first became known for his 2006 song "Dig Dug (Shake It)", which became popular in his hometown of Germantown, Maryland and led Wale to gain further local recognition as he amassed a number of follow-up releases. He signed a recording contract with English DJ-producer Mark Ronson's Allido Records in 2007, which, after a three-label bidding war, entered a joint venture with Interscope Records for US$1.3 million the following year. During this time, Wale's mixtapes and singles saw national attention as he appeared on MTV and various Black America-focused magazines. Roscoe Dash
Jeffery Lee Johnson Jr. (born April 2, 1990), better known by his stage name Roscoe Dash, is an American rapper. He is best known for his guest appearance alongside Wale on Waka Flocka Flame's 2010 single "No Hands," which peaked at number 13 on the ''Billboard'' Hot 100 and received diamond certification by the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A). He signed with Zone 4, Geffen, and Interscope Records to release his debut single, " All the Way Turnt Up" (featuring Soulja Boy), in January of that year, which peaked within the top 50 of the chart and preceded his debut studio album, '' Ready Set Go!'' (2010). Due to erroneous circumstances regarding its release, it failed to chart and was admitted by Roscoe Dash himself to be unfinished. No Hands
"No Hands" is a song recorded by American rapper Waka Flocka Flame featuring fellow American rappers Roscoe Dash and Wale (rapper), Wale from the former's debut studio album, ''Flockaveli'' (2010). It was written by the artists alongside producer Drumma Boy. It was leaked in May 2010 before it was officially released in August. The single (music), single entered the Billboard Hot 100, ''Billboard'' Hot 100 chart at number 45 and peaked at number 13. On July 20, 2023, the song was certified Diamond certification, diamond by RIAA selling over 10 million copies, his first diamond certification and one of the best-selling rap songs of all-time. The song has since come to be regarded as Waka's signature song. Background According to ''Spin (magazine), Spin'', the song finds each performer emceeing a strip club environment while intoxicated.
